A growing logistics company based in Ipswich is seeking an experienced Transport Operator to join their team. The ideal candidate will have at least 3 years of experience in Transport Operating, along with familiarity with VBS Systems.

Responsibilities include:

  • Routing and planning deliveries
  • Ensuring compliance with transport regulations
  • Communicating effectively with drivers and clients

This position offers a chance to make a significant impact within a dynamic environment.
